2. Expertise profiles and user activity are now priced separately
Starmind automatically creates an expertise profile for anyone whose work it can analyze. For example, someone who authors documents in SharePoint or contributes to public chats in Teams or Slack. These people don’t need to log in or use Starmind directly to be included in the system’s knowledge map.
Now, you only pay for:
- Expertise profiles – How many people’s knowledge you want to map
- Active users – How many people interact with Starmind by asking or answering questions
This means you can capture knowledge across the organization without licensing every employee as a user.

Starmind Solutions and Pricing Structure
All products are powered by the Knowledge Engine. Start with expertise mapping, then add tools as needed.
-
Knowledge Engine
Starmind’s core intelligence layer. It continuously maps who knows what and how work gets done, based on real activity across your tools.
What makes it different
- Headless, API-first platform that integrates into your stack
- Learns from real collaboration signals—not manual input
- Always current, no tagging or upkeep required
- Powers copilots, dashboards, search, and more
Pricing: $4,000/month for up to 500 expertise profiles
-
Expert Finder
For just-in-time collaboration. Expert Finder connects employees to the right internal expert, directly in Microsoft Teams or Slack.
What makes it different
- Routes based on real-time activity—not job titles or static directories
- Embedded in your existing tools to preserve workflow focus
- Surfaces expertise even when it’s not documented
- Keeps conversations private—no data is stored
Best For: Fast answers, cross-functional help, and reducing channel noise
Pricing: $0.60 per active user/month
-
Knowledge Suite
For structured knowledge capture and reuse. Knowledge Suite turns employee questions into high-quality, validated answers.
What makes it different
- Anonymous submission encourages openness
- Expert routing powered by live signals, not role lists
- Peer review and expiry ensure content quality
- Detects similar questions to boost reuse and reduce noise
- Load-balances requests to avoid SME burnout
Best For: Building a living internal knowledge base, reducing repeated questions
Pricing: $1.80 per active user/month
